General Information

Work Title Françoise de Rimini
Alternative. Title Opéra en quatre actes
Name Translations リミニのフランソワーズ
Authorities WorldCat; Wikipedia; VIAF: 179682361; GND: 102417431X; BNF: 14792566k
Composer Thomas, Ambroise
I-Catalogue NumberI-Cat. No. IAT 6
Movements/SectionsMov'ts/Sec's 4 Acts
First Performance. 1882-04-14
First Publication. 1882
Librettist Jules Barbier (1825-1901) and Michel Carré (1819-1872)
Language French
Composer Time PeriodComp. Period Romantic
Piece Style Romantic
Instrumentation Vocal soloists, Chorus, Orchestra
